344 lines
7.9 KiB
TOML
344 lines
7.9 KiB
TOML
tick = "5m"
|
|
|
|
playerQn = [15, 16, 32, 48, 64, 80]
|
|
playerVipQn = [74,112,116]
|
|
PlayerAPI = "http://172.18.33.143:13500/playurl/batch"
|
|
PGCPlayerAPI = "http://api.bilibili.co/pgc/internal/dynamic/aid/list"
|
|
PlayerSwitch = true
|
|
|
|
[videoshot]
|
|
uri = "http://i3.hdslb.com/bfs/videoshot/"
|
|
key = "f555a0f529152dc8c6b1ae60c2af4164"
|
|
|
|
[xlog]
|
|
dir = "/data/log/archive-service/"
|
|
|
|
[statsd]
|
|
project = "archive-service"
|
|
addr = "172.18.20.15:8200"
|
|
chanSize = 10240
|
|
|
|
[app]
|
|
key = "53e2fa226f5ad348"
|
|
secret = "3cf6bd1b0ff671021da5f424fea4b04a"
|
|
|
|
[bm]
|
|
[bm.inner]
|
|
addr = "0.0.0.0:6081"
|
|
timeout = "1s"
|
|
[bm.local]
|
|
addr = "0.0.0.0:6082"
|
|
timeout = "1s"
|
|
|
|
[rpcServer2]
|
|
discoverOff = false
|
|
token = "123456"
|
|
[[rpcServer2.servers]]
|
|
proto = "tcp"
|
|
addr = "0.0.0.0:6089"
|
|
weight = 10
|
|
group = "test"
|
|
[rpcServer2.zookeeper]
|
|
root = "/microservice/archive-service/"
|
|
addrs = ["172.18.33.172:2181"]
|
|
timeout = "30s"
|
|
|
|
[db]
|
|
[db.arc]
|
|
name =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/bilibili_archive?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8,utf8mb4"
|
|
active = 5
|
|
idle = 1
|
|
idleTimeout ="4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.arc.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[db.arcRead]
|
|
addr =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/bilibili_archive?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8,utf8mb4"
|
|
active = 5
|
|
idle = 5
|
|
idleTimeout = "4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.arcRead.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[db.arcResult]
|
|
name =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/archive_result?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8"
|
|
active = 5
|
|
idle = 1
|
|
idleTimeout = "4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.arcResult.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[db.stat]
|
|
name =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/archive_stat?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8"
|
|
active = 5
|
|
idle = 1
|
|
idleTimeout = "4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.stat.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[db.click]
|
|
name =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/archive_click?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8"
|
|
active = 5
|
|
idle = 1
|
|
idleTimeout = "4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.click.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[db.like]
|
|
name = "172.16.33.205:3308"
|
|
dsn = "test:test@tcp(172.16.33.205:3308)/archive_like?timeout=200ms&readTimeout=200ms&writeTimeout=200ms&parseTime=true&loc=Local&charset=utf8"
|
|
active = 10
|
|
idle = 5
|
|
idleTimeout = "4h"
|
|
queryTimeout = "150ms"
|
|
execTimeout = "100ms"
|
|
tranTimeout = "200ms"
|
|
[db.like.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
|
|
[ecode]
|
|
domain = "172.16.33.248:6401"
|
|
all = "1h"
|
|
diff = "5m"
|
|
[ecode.clientconfig]
|
|
key = "test"
|
|
secret = "e6c4c252dc7e3d8a90805eecd7c73396"
|
|
dial = "2000ms"
|
|
timeout = "2s"
|
|
keepAlive = "10s"
|
|
timer = 128
|
|
[ecode.clientconfig.breaker]
|
|
window ="3s"
|
|
sleep ="100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[ecode.app]
|
|
key = "test"
|
|
secret = "e6c4c252dc7e3d8a90805eecd7c73396"
|
|
|
|
[identify]
|
|
whiteAccessKey = ""
|
|
whiteMid = 0
|
|
[identify.app]
|
|
key = "6a29f8ed87407c11"
|
|
secret = "d3c5a85f5b895a03735b5d20a273bc57"
|
|
[identify.host]
|
|
auth = "http://passport.bilibili.com"
|
|
secret = "http://open.bilibili.com"
|
|
[identify.httpClient]
|
|
key = "6a29f8ed87407c11"
|
|
secret = "d3c5a85f5b895a03735b5d20a273bc57"
|
|
dial = "30ms"
|
|
timeout = "100ms"
|
|
keepAlive = "60s"
|
|
[identify.httpClient.breaker]
|
|
window = "10s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[identify.httpClient.url]
|
|
"http://passport.bilibili.co/intranet/auth/tokenInfo" = {timeout = "100ms"}
|
|
"http://passport.bilibili.co/intranet/auth/cookieInfo" = {timeout = "100ms"}
|
|
"http://open.bilibili.co/api/getsecret" = {timeout = "500ms"}
|
|
|
|
[memcache]
|
|
[memcache.archive]
|
|
name = "archive-service"
|
|
proto = "tcp"
|
|
addr = "172.18.33.61:11211"
|
|
active = 50
|
|
idle = 10
|
|
dialTimeout = "30ms"
|
|
readTimeout = "200ms"
|
|
writeTimeout = "200ms"
|
|
idleTimeout = "80s"
|
|
archiveExpire = "10h"
|
|
videoExpire = "10h"
|
|
|
|
[redis]
|
|
[redis.archive]
|
|
name = "archive-service/archive"
|
|
proto = "tcp"
|
|
addr = "172.16.33.54:6379"
|
|
idle = 50
|
|
active = 100
|
|
dialTimeout = "100ms"
|
|
readTimeout = "200ms"
|
|
writeTimeout = "200ms"
|
|
idleTimeout = "80s"
|
|
expire = "8h"
|
|
[redis.relation]
|
|
name = "archive-service/relation"
|
|
proto = "tcp"
|
|
addr = "172.16.33.54:6379"
|
|
idle = 10
|
|
active = 10
|
|
dialTimeout = "5s"
|
|
readTimeout = "200ms"
|
|
writeTimeout = "200ms"
|
|
idleTimeout = "80s"
|
|
[redis.like]
|
|
name = "archive-service/like"
|
|
proto = "tcp"
|
|
addr = "172.16.33.54:6379"
|
|
idle = 10
|
|
active = 10
|
|
dialTimeout = "30ms"
|
|
readTimeout = "200ms"
|
|
writeTimeout = "200ms"
|
|
idleTimeout = "80s"
|
|
|
|
[kafkaProducer]
|
|
firstShareTopic = "share_first"
|
|
brokers = ["172.16.33.54:9092"]
|
|
sync = false
|
|
[kafkaProducer.zookeeper]
|
|
root = "/kafka"
|
|
addrs = ["172.18.33.172:2181"]
|
|
timeout = "30s"
|
|
|
|
[databus]
|
|
key = "0PtNTguCX35XCtPpjUGC"
|
|
secret= "0PtNTguCX35XCtPpjUGD"
|
|
group= "Stat-UGC-P"
|
|
topic= "Stat-T"
|
|
action="pub"
|
|
name = "archive-service/stat"
|
|
proto = "tcp"
|
|
addr = "172.16.33.56:6201"
|
|
idle = 100
|
|
active = 100
|
|
dialTimeout = "1s"
|
|
readTimeout = "1s"
|
|
writeTimeout = "1s"
|
|
idleTimeout = "10s"
|
|
expire = "1h"
|
|
|
|
[CacheDatabus]
|
|
key = "8e27ab7e39270b59"
|
|
secret= "477df6a068d7332a163f95abbad2079c"
|
|
group= "ArchiveUserCache-MainAppSvr-P"
|
|
topic= "ArchiveUserCache-T"
|
|
action="pub"
|
|
name = "archive-service/stat"
|
|
proto = "tcp"
|
|
addr = "172.18.33.50:6205"
|
|
idle = 5
|
|
active = 50
|
|
dialTimeout = "1s"
|
|
readTimeout = "1s"
|
|
writeTimeout = "1s"
|
|
idleTimeout = "10s"
|
|
expire = "1h"
|
|
|
|
[StatDatabus]
|
|
key = "4c76cbb7a985ac90"
|
|
secret= "8c22a196bf00d623b69cba4e61b1f7dc"
|
|
group= "StatShare-MainArchive-P"
|
|
topic= "StatShare-T"
|
|
action="pub"
|
|
offset="old"
|
|
buffer=1024
|
|
name = "archive-service/StatShare"
|
|
proto = "tcp"
|
|
addr = "172.16.33.56:6201"
|
|
idle = 5
|
|
active = 50
|
|
dialTimeout = "80ms"
|
|
readTimeout = "80ms"
|
|
writeTimeout = "80ms"
|
|
idleTimeout = "80s"
|
|
|
|
[shareDatabus]
|
|
key = "8e27ab7e39270b59"
|
|
secret= "e5d94158a1118c14e1449481023edacf"
|
|
group= "AccountExp-MainAppSvr-P"
|
|
topic= "AccountExp-T"
|
|
action="pub"
|
|
name = "archive-service/share"
|
|
proto = "tcp"
|
|
addr = "172.16.33.56:6201"
|
|
idle = 100
|
|
active = 100
|
|
dialTimeout = "1s"
|
|
readTimeout = "1s"
|
|
writeTimeout = "1s"
|
|
idleTimeout = "10s"
|
|
expire = "1h"
|
|
|
|
[limiter]
|
|
domain = "api.bilibili.co"
|
|
family = "archive-service"
|
|
all = "2h"
|
|
diff = "2s"
|
|
[limiter.clientconfig]
|
|
key = "53e2fa226f5ad348"
|
|
secret = "3cf6bd1b0ff671021da5f424fea4b04a"
|
|
dial = "1s"
|
|
timeout = "2s"
|
|
keepAlive = "10s"
|
|
timer = 128
|
|
[limiter.clientconfig.breaker]
|
|
window ="3s"
|
|
sleep ="100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|
|
[limiter.app]
|
|
key = "53e2fa226f5ad348"
|
|
secret = "3cf6bd1b0ff671021da5f424fea4b04a"
|
|
|
|
[playerClient]
|
|
key = "53e2fa226f5ad348"
|
|
secret = "3cf6bd1b0ff671021da5f424fea4b04a"
|
|
dial = "50ms"
|
|
timeout = "500ms"
|
|
keepAlive = "60s"
|
|
[playerClient.breaker]
|
|
window = "3s"
|
|
sleep = "100ms"
|
|
bucket = 10
|
|
ratio = 0.5
|
|
request = 100
|